NVIDIA Technical Analysis

NVIDIA Corporation (NASDAQ: NVDA) closed at $120.69 on March 25, 2025, down 0.59% for the day. The stock is currently trading below both its 50-day and 200-day moving averages, which indicates a short-term bearish trend.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) sits at 54, suggesting a neutral momentum neither in overbought nor oversold territory. The MACD shows a negative divergence of -8.21, indicating potential continued weakness in the short term. The Average True Range (ATR) of 4.75 points to potential volatility. Support is identified at $120.15, while immediate resistance lies at $123.70.

Fundamental Analysis

From a fundamental standpoint, Nvidia is considered a leader in AI and data center markets, bolstered by a recent 78% YoY revenue increase due to its robust AI-driven solutions and Blackwell Ultra architecture. However, its PE ratio of 41.05 implies a high valuation relative to its earnings. The DCF valuation suggests an intrinsic value of $178.79, indicating that the stock may be undervalued at its current price, given analysts' consensus price target of $180.04. The dividend yield (TTM) is relatively low at 0.07%, reflecting a focus on reinvestment for growth.

Long-Term Investment Potential

Nvidia's position as a dominant player in AI infrastructure and its strong growth potential perceived through new architectures and libraries make it a compelling long-term prospect. The volatility and high PE indicate risks, but its undervalued intrinsic price and innovation capacity provide a favorable outlook. The recent news of Nvidia and Oracle urging changes in AI chip trade suggests potential future strategic advantages.

Overall Evaluation

Considering the technical indicators pointing to short-term volatility and the strong fundamental growth prospects, Nvidia is categorized as a 'Hold'. The potential for long-term appreciation exists, particularly with strategic innovations and market developments, but current market conditions and valuations advise caution for immediate buying moves.
